Achieving consistent pitch accuracy requires establishing both technical precision and musical understanding via focused listening and repetitive rehearsal. This fundamental skill distinguishes amateur singers from expert performers, as listeners immediately detect when notes drop sharp or flat of their intended targets. Ear training drills help singers recognize pitch relationships, intervals, and harmonic progressions that inform accurate intonation during performance. Many singers gain from practicing with piano accompaniment or pitch reference devices during practice sessions, gradually weaning themselves from external support as internal tonal awareness matures. Expanding one's vocal range represents a progressive process that requires persistence, correct technique, and reasonable expectations regarding natural limitations. Most vocalists have a comfortable range spanning approximately two octaves, though this can be extended with mindful training and regular vocal practice. The journey involves reinforcing the vocal muscles responsible for pitch adjustment while maintaining flexibility and avoiding tension that restricts motion. Lower register development typically focuses on chest voice strengthening and smooth transitions between registers, while upper-range expansion calls for careful head voice cultivation and blended voice coordination.
